Samuel B. Bacharach, Peter A. Bamberger, and William J. Sonnenstuhl. Ithaca, NY: Cornell University press, 2001. 200 pp. $42.50, cloth; $16.95, paper.
The study presented in this book is a challenge to the widely diffused notion of the collapse of community in America as we now choose to go bowling alone (Putnam, 2000). In a set of scenarios that offer a sharp contrast to the vision of the collapse of community, the authors describe in splendid detail the emergence and revitalization of the logic of mutual aid in the labor movement.
